Exploring the Historical Significance of Henry VII, Elizabeth of York, Henry VIII, and Jane Seymour

The Tudor Dynasty: A Legacy of Power and Influence

Understanding the Context of the Tudor Era

The Tudor era, spanning from 1485 to 1603, marked a transformative period in English history. This time was characterized by political intrigue, religious upheaval, and the establishment of a powerful monarchy. The reign of Henry VII laid the foundation for the Tudor dynasty, which would see significant changes in governance and culture. The marriage of Henry VII to Elizabeth of York symbolized the unification of the warring houses of Lancaster and York, creating a new era of stability.

Historical Context: The Lives of the Tudor Monarchs

Henry VII: The Founder of the Tudor Dynasty

Henry VII's reign marked the end of the Wars of the Roses and the beginning of a new royal lineage. His strategic marriages and political alliances strengthened his claim to the throne and established a legacy that would influence England for generations.

Elizabeth of York: The Bridge Between Houses

Elizabeth of York was more than just a queen; she was a symbol of unity. Her marriage to Henry VII brought together two rival factions, fostering peace and stability in a time of turmoil. Her lineage would also play a crucial role in the future of the monarchy.

Henry VIII: The King Who Changed England

Henry VIII is perhaps the most famous Tudor monarch, known for his dramatic reign and the English Reformation. His desire for a male heir led to significant religious and political changes, reshaping the landscape of England.

Jane Seymour: The Queen Who Gave Him a Son

Jane Seymour holds a unique place in Tudor history as the only wife of Henry VIII to bear him a son, Edward VI. Her tragic death shortly after childbirth added to the drama of Henry's reign and his subsequent marriages.
